Costs of Indoor Basketball Flooring Options and Installation


Understanding Indoor Basketball Flooring Prices


When it comes to outfitting an indoor basketball court, one of the most critical considerations is the flooring. The right basketball flooring not only enhances player performance but also ensures safety and durability over time. With a variety of options available on the market, understanding the prices associated with different types of indoor basketball flooring can help you make an informed decision.


Types of Indoor Basketball Flooring


1. Hardwood Flooring Hardwood is often considered the gold standard for basketball courts. Traditional gymnasiums are typically made of maple wood, which provides a smooth playing surface and excellent shock absorption. The prices for hardwood flooring can vary significantly, generally ranging from $4 to $10 per square foot, depending on the quality and where the wood is sourced. Installation costs can also add $2 to $4 per square foot.


2. Vinyl Flooring An increasingly popular alternative to hardwood is vinyl flooring. This material is durable, easy to maintain, and comes in a variety of designs, including those that mimic wood grain. The price for vinyl flooring typically ranges from $2 to $5 per square foot, making it a more budget-friendly option. The installation costs can be similar to those of hardwood, but vinyl can often be installed over existing floors, reducing preparation costs.


3. Rubber Flooring Rubber flooring is another option, particularly suited for multi-purpose facilities. It is not only durable and water-resistant but also provides excellent grip and shock absorption, reducing the risk of injury. Prices for rubber flooring generally range from $3 to $7 per square foot. While the initial costs may be similar to other materials, the longevity and low maintenance of rubber can make it a cost-effective investment over time.


4. Synthetic Flooring Synthetic or composite flooring systems combine various materials to provide a balanced performance. These flooring systems are designed to be low-maintenance and can be customized to meet specific performance needs. Prices tend to range from $4 to $8 per square foot, with installation costs varying based on the complexity of the system.


Factors Influencing Costs


Several factors can affect the overall cost of indoor basketball flooring

- Material Quality Higher quality materials generally cost more but often provide better performance and durability.


- Installation Complexity Some flooring materials require more intensive preparation and installation, which can drive up costs.


- Size of the Facility The total square footage of the gym will significantly impact the overall cost. Larger facilities will often benefit from bulk pricing, reducing the per square foot cost.


- Custom Features Custom logos, markings, or unique designs can add to the overall cost.


- Geographical Location Labor and material costs vary by region, which can influence flooring prices.
